Output 088fb30843bebb0e94447f42d42a71539678ae754666762a2769cd7a301153a8:5

value
27933172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2953c4e01b34cb30f44c13a0b729206ffe8b8f96 OP_EQUAL
address
MBfgHfqnaDbCZu2uECxZgqnexC7gq6jwtz
transaction
088fb30843bebb0e94447f42d42a71539678ae754666762a2769cd7a301153a8
spent
true